The fifth edition of Military Law in a Nutshell by L. Lynn Hogue has been revised and updated, providing a concise summary of military law and justice for practicing lawyers, cadets, students, and members of the Army, Navy, Air Force, or Coast Guard Judge Advocate General's Corps.

In this edition, a dedicated Guide to Seeking Justice for Former Servicemembers with Bad Paper Discharges has been introduced. Extensive efforts have been made to incorporate the latest changes in the Uniform Code of Military Justice (UCMJ). This guide provides valuable insights and guidance for those who have faced adverse consequences in their military careers.

The book is organized into easily accessible chapters, each covering key aspects of military law and justice. It begins with an introduction to the legal framework and principles governing the armed services, followed by a detailed exploration of the UCMJ and its application. The book also delves into topics such as military commissions, court-martial procedures, and the rights and responsibilities of service members during military operations.

Throughout the text, real-world examples and case studies are used to illustrate the practical implications of military law and justice. These examples help to bring the subject matter to life and provide a deeper understanding of the challenges and complexities faced by service members and their legal representatives.

In addition to its comprehensive coverage of military law and justice, the fifth edition of Military Law in a Nutshell also includes a comprehensive appendix that provides valuable resources and references for further study. This appendix includes a list of military legal organizations, a glossary of legal terms, and a timeline of significant military legal events.
